
Clothes Bank Facilitator
Do you want to make a difference by helping give clothes a second life?
At our Foodbank and Family Hub we have rails of beautiful, donated clothing on display for people to browse. We give away these clothes to those that need them the most, but we also offer them at a subsidised rate to those that can afford it so that any money made can go straight back into our charity. We need people who can sort through donations, rotate the stock on the rails and keep a record of the clothes given away.
How many hours per week? Depending on your availability, from 3 hours to 9 hours per week.
When? Tuesdays, Wednesdays and Thursdays, 10am-1pm.
Where? The WELLcome Hub, 35 Vicarage Lane, East Ham, E66DQ
You will need to provide: An efficient manner in being able to sort through clothes and display them effectively, warm and welcoming attitude and an ability to keep records.
What we’ll provide: A full induction and training, reimbursed travel costs, lots of free tea and coffee, and a warm meal each session.
